OCP-1Z0-052-V8.02-187题

187. Which two statements describe good practices for an application developer to reduce locking

conflicts in Oracle database? (Choose two.)

A.Avoid coding unnecessary long-running transactions.

B.Allow the database to handle locks in default locking mode.

C.Always explicitly code the locks as per the requirement of the application.

D.Allow escalation of row locks to block locks if too many row locks cause problem. 

Answer: AB  

答案解析:

参考:http://blog.csdn.net/rlhua/article/details/12652569


题意:哪两个语句描述了Oracle数据库应用程序开发人员在减少锁定冲突的良好做法?


A,避免编码不必要的长时间运行的事务。正确,长时间的事务占据资源太多,别的用户无法访问。避免编码避免编码不必要的长时间运行的事务,可提高事务的运行。

B,允许数据库来处理锁在默认锁定模式。正确。这样排队机制是自动运行的,不需要人来干预。

C,始终明确编写的锁每个应用程序的要求。错误,如果以后要修改,还要修改程序。麻烦。

D,如果有太多的行锁导致的问题,允许行锁升级来阻止锁。错误,应该是去解决锁冲突,而不是升级锁来阻止锁。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值